נָפִישׁ
na.phishProper Noun (Masculine)H5305
Naphish
From: from H5314 (נָפַשׁ); refreshed;
Short Definition
Naphish, a son of Ishmael, and his posterity
Full Lexicon Entry
A man of the Arabs living at the time of the Patriarchs, first mentioned at ; son of: Ishmael (H3458); brother of: Nebaioth (H5032), Kedar (H6938), Adbeel (H0110), Mibsam (H4017), Mishma (H4927), Dumah (H1746), Massa (H4854), Hadad (H2301), Tema (H8485), Jetur (H3195), Kedemah (H6929) and Mahalath (H4258) § Naphish or Nephish = "refreshment" 1) the next to last son of Ishmael 2) an Arabian tribe
